Sometimes my NESTLÉ TOLL HOUSE Refrigerated Cookie Dough cookies come out overdone and hard. How do I make the cookies so that they are soft?

• If you like softer cookies, we recommend that you begin checking the cookies for doneness at the minimum bake time. You can always add a minute or two if they are not done enough. Most of our cookies should be baked till the edges are light golden brown and centers are set. The appearance of the cookies may look a little underbaked, but they will continue baking as they are cooling on the baking sheets and also when removed to the wire racks to cool completely. • The NESTLÉ Kitchens recommend that the cookies cool for 2 minutes on the baking sheets prior to removing to the wire racks to cool completely. This is a very important step that must not be overlooked! Cooling the cookies on the baking sheet for this short amount of time allows the cookies to set up. However, allowing the cookies to cool completely on the baking sheet can result in overbaked and hard cookies! Not cooling cookies on a wire rack will “steam” the cookie.
